US Review, which was intended to uteet tho wants of many students of Chinese caused by the discontinuance of 'Notas and Queries on Ching and Japan, has reached its Twenty-fient Volume. The Reviews discusana those topics which are uppermost in the minds of students of the Far East and about which every intelligent person con- nected with China or Japan is desirous of acquiring trustworthy information. It fa- oludes many intersting Notes and original Papers on the Arte, Sciences, Ethnology, Folklore, Goography, Bistory, Literature, Mythology, Natural History, Antiquities, and Social Manners and Customse, ato., etc., of China, Japan, Mongolia, Tibot, and the Far East generally. Recently a new de- parture has been taken, and the Review now gives papers Trade, Commerit, and Descriptive notes of Travel. by well-known writers. It was thought that by extending the scope of the Review in his direction, the Magazine would be made more generally useful,
The Review department receives special attention, and endeavours are made to present a careful and concise record of Literature on China etc., and to give critiques embodying skatches of the Most recent works on such topics.
